What does this role entail? The Maintenance Technician performs technical and mechanical work that ensures the inside and external buildings, grounds, amenities, and common areas of the property meet the Company’s standards for cleanliness, appearance, safety, and overall functionality by performing maintenance related tasks.
Pay Rate - $23.00 - $25.00 / HR
Schedule: 40 hours in a regular work week.

To perform this job successfully, the requirements listed below are representative of the knowledge, skills, and/or abilities required. Reasonable accommodation may be made to enable individuals with disabilities to perform the essential job functions.
Education: High School Diploma or GED Equivalent Experience Preferred: 1-3 years of apartment maintenance experience or equivalent preferred.
Communication and Delivery Skills with ability to connect to people at all levels.
Proficiency in internet, word processing, spreadsheet, and database management programs for reporting purposes. Strong proficiency in property management software (preferably Entrata Yardi and/or One Site).
Licenses: Current Valid Driver's License Certifications: Maintenace Technicians must have EPA certifications Type I and II or Universal for refrigerant recycling as well as all certifications required by State and Local jurisdictions.
Weights Requirements: Must be able to push, pull, lift, carry, or maneuver weights up to 50 pounds independently and 150 pounds with assistance.
